Cold bubble

The density current test case

Geometry:
Computational domain extends in horizontal direction from -25.6 to 25.6 km and in vertical direction from 0 to 6.4 km.
Integration time: t=1800s
Profile: Temperature

\(\theta = 3000\,K \)
\(\Delta T = \begin{cases}
0.0 \text{if}\quad L \gt 1.0, \\
-15.0 \cos(L \pi/2) \text{if}\quad L \le 1.0
\end{cases}\)
where
\(L = ((\frac{x-x_{c}}{x_{r}})^{2} + (\frac{z-z_{c}}{z_{r}}^{2}))^{1/2}\)
and
\(x_{c}=0.0.\,km ; x_{r}=4.0\,km ; z_{c}=3.0 \,km\) and \(z_{r}=2.0 \,km\)
